Reliance Jio, earlier, tried to enter into the Indian smartphone market. But later it’s focus moved to other parts of the business. In the last AGM Reliance got Google as a partner and declared to bring high-quality affordable smartphones for the needy Indians. Now, it looks like the mission is on the track.
As per a report of Bloomberg, Reliance Industries Ltd. has asked the local suppliers to increase their production capacity so that they can produce around 200 million smartphones in the next two years. People familiar with this matter told this to Bloomberg. With this road map, Reliance Industries Ltd. surely can challenge companies like Xiaomi.
Sources are saying, the Ambani team is in talks with the domestic assemblers to manufacture a new version of the Jio Phone that will run on Android and costs around Rs.4,000 ($54) only. Along with the inexpensive phones, Reliance will also bundle low-cost wireless plans too.
No doubt, with this aggressive pricing there is a high chance to establish its dominance in the Indian smartphone market very quickly, as it did earlier with the low-cost Jio plans. The company also availing government plans to build more domestic manufacturing. There is a chance that assemblers like Dixon Technologies India, Lava International, and Karbonn Mobile will face the boost.
Pankaj Mohindroo, the Chairman of the Indian Cellular & Electronics Association said to Bloomberg in an interview, “We are of course trying to build our domestic companies. We have a sweet spot in entry-level phones,”“The world has realized that India is a great place to do business and a great place to do manufacturing also.” he added further.

The Luis Suarez transfer saga has taken yet another twist. A latest news report has suggested that after the option of terminating his contract was agreed, the Barcelona president Bartomeu has blocked the transfer.
Suarez already had a clause in his contract which restricted him from moving to top clubs around the world, but it is believed that Atletico Madrid was not on that list. But now that the board has seen that there is a way to recover some funds from Suarez’s 1-year duration remaining on his contract, they plan to use that to full effect.
This development comes after the very reliable Fabrizio Romano had reported that Suarez was keen on a move to Atletico Madrid and had even agreed on a two-year contract with them.
The blocking of the transfer changes things for both Suarez and Atletico. For the former, options are now drying out and he may have to contemplate staying at Barcelona without much game time.
For Atletico, they may switch their focus to signing veteran striker Edinson Cavani on a free transfer, given the striker profiles more or less match the same. They are forced to sign a new striker because Juventus have convinced Alvaro Morata to join them on an initial loan with an obligation to buy.
More from wiretaps about the Luis Suarez/exam story. “He does not speak a word of Italian. He does not conjugate verbs, he only speaks using the infinitive. If journalists would ask him some questions, he’d be lost. He earns €10m/year, he needs to pass this exam” 🚨 [Repubblica]
Even the earlier touted move of Suarez to Juventus now seems like a dead-end, considering the latest update is that he has failed his Italian language required for his passport acquirement.
Another rumour early in the market was to make a return to his old club Ajax for a minimal fee, but even that seems to have reached a dead end. A slight chance of a return to Liverpool is also out of the question, now that Diego Jota has signed for the Reds.
So as it stands, the Uruguayan striker’s future remains bleak and is still unclear on where he will be plying his trade this season.

Thanks to the TENAA website, it has now confirmed that Realme is willing to add a new smartphone into its X series. Two model name had surfaced on the Chinese TENAA database – RMX2173 and RMX2117. According to rumours, RMX2117 will be a member of the Q-series smartphone from Realme. But RMX2173 will come with a trading name of Realme X7 Lite or Realm X7 Youth. The TENAA database also reveals some key specifications of this upcoming phone.
There are some leaks in the media about the new outline design and quite a few specs of this new smartphone from Realme. Let’s check out these specifications.
Realme X7 Lite Specifications(Expected)
Regarding the display, the phone sports a 6.43″ S-AMOLED punch-hole display with Full HD+ resolution of (1080×2700) pixels and an aspect ratio of 20:9. The phone features an under-screen fingerprint scanner. The dimension of this upcoming phone is (160.9×74.4×8.1) mm and it weighs 175 grams.
According to the TENAA datasheet, this upcoming phone has a 2.4GHz octa-core processor and the phone may arrive in China in two types of variants-6GB and 8GB and storage options like 128GB and 256GB. The storage capacity may be expanded through a Micro SD card. This upcoming phone will be run on Android 10 OS.
Regarding the camera part, the phone will feature 48 megapixels as the main shooter alongside and an 8MP+2MP+2MP quad rear camera setup whereas the predecessor, Realme X7 flaunts 64MP (main)+8MP (ultrawide)+2MP (macro)+2MP (depth). The Realme X7 Lite has 16 megapixels front camera.
The phone will be backed by a dual-cell battery, but the TENAA listing mentions the rated size of one of its cells as 2,100 mAh. But the charging speed is not known to yet.

Despite being 35-year-old, Cristiano Ronaldo is still among the two best players in the world right now. The other player, of course, being Lionel Messi.
Ronaldo has dominated the game no matter which team he has joined. Starting with Manchester United, to Real Madrid and now to Juventus, the Portuguese is one of the greatest players to have ever played the game.
✨ The name of the best player ever is now perpetuated at our Academy ✨
In recognition of his success, talent and legendary status in world football, Sporting CP have renamed their academy, ‘Academia Cristiano Ronaldo‘.
In an official statement released by the club on their website, they stated: “It is with great honour that Sporting Clube de Portugal informs that the Clube Academy will be renamed Academia Cristiano Ronaldo.”
“The good son makes the house and the house that made Cristiano Ronaldo now welcomes his name in honour of the one who became the best Portuguese player of all time, the best player in the world, was awarded the Ballon d’Or five times and captained the national team to European Championship and Nations League success.”
“Cristiano Ronaldo joined the Leonina family in 1997 at the age of 12. On August 14, 2002, at just 17 years old, he made his senior debut against Inter.”
“The Academy will thus immortalise the name of the greatest symbol ever formed and that will be an inspiration to follow for all the youngest talents.
“On a date to be announced, and as soon as conditions permit, the club will make the official inauguration.”
Ronaldo started his career coming out of the Sporting CP academy, and joined Manchester United at the age of 18. The rest, as they say, is history.
The Portuguese has won five Ballon d’Ors, multiple Champions League titles and the league title with every club that he has been a part of.

Sony Ericsson had released the Xperia Play in the year of 2011 and it also got some good reviews. But after that, the company has not announced any successor of that phone. Now after 9 long years, Sony has surfaced an Xperia Play 2 prototype on Alibaba’s second-hand marketplace, Idle Fish. The main highlight of the Xperia Play model was its slide-out gamepad, considering a vast improvement over the Nokia N-Gage that came out eight years prior.
According to the prototype, the Xperia Play 2 looks like a more refined and improved version than its predecessor. It shows that the upcoming device features shoulder buttons, along with a 3D button. As of now, the use of this 3D button is still not cleared, but it may have been similar to the stereoscopic effect that the 3DS achieved. These are some of the little things which are known yet about the upcoming Sony Xperia Play 2.
